Hello:

New to this forum, but eager to hear others thoughts on my issue. I had a root canal done 16 days ago. It isn't complete; need to go back in two weeks. However, the dentist said he got most of it clean. His plan is to put a crown on the tooth as time passes. I was on a round of antibiotics for 10 days that I completed 2 days ago. However, I still have soarness in my jaw, near my ear. I do not have any clicking, but my jaw hurts to the point that I just took 600mg ibuprofen I can chew on that side, but don't really want to for fear of more pain. Laying down seems to make it worse. I can live with it, but feel like I should be pain free at this point. My dentist isn't saying much regarding this pain. It's not excruciating pain, but annoying soreness and a little pain near my ear.

Hi :welcome: to the forum.

It is normal for a treated tooth and the area around it to still feel a bit unsettled. It has just had extensive work done on it. I am not a dentist but I have over the last year or so had a rct'd tooth to deal with.

Your jaw may be sore if you grind or clench your teeth. I would contact your dentist if the pain gets really bad that pain meds won't calm down. It could also be that there is a bit of nerve still in the tooth, has your dentist taken an x ray to make sure that he has got all of the canals clear.

I am sure he will check when you go back for the second part of the treatment.
